I have the Ninja Dual zone and love that I can cook different food at different temps at the same time. Also, the “smart finish” option will hold the food that has less time to cook, then starts when the same amount of time is left in the other basket so that they finish at the same time. I also love the match cook option when I’m feeding a lot and need both baskets for the same food.
